Arctotis/African Daisy Seed ( Annual )

Grow Arctotis for their vibrant, daisy-like flowers in a wide range of colors, attractive silvery-green foliage, and low-maintenance, drought-tolerant nature. They are resilient to pests and thrive in various conditions, making them excellent for rock gardens, containers, borders, and coastal areas, especially where soil is light and well-drained.

2578 African Daisy ( Arctotis grandis )

African Daisy is one of the most striking flowering annuals available, producing large daisy-like blooms with brilliant white petals surrounding dramatic steel-blue to purple centers encircled by a golden halo. Native to the sunny landscapes of South Africa, this spectacular flower brings exotic beauty and long-lasting color to gardens, borders, containers, and wildflower plantings. The elegant blooms seem to glow in sunlight and create an unforgettable display from late spring through fall.

The flowers open wide during sunny weather and close during cloudy conditions or at night, a fascinating characteristic that adds life and movement to the garden. Their bold color contrast and exceptional flower size make African Daisy a favorite among gardeners seeking something beyond ordinary bedding plants.

Growing Information

African Daisy thrives in full sun and well-drained soil. Plants typically reach 18 to 30 inches in height and develop a bushy, spreading habit covered with blooms throughout the growing season. They perform exceptionally well in hot, sunny locations where many other flowers struggle.

Once established, plants tolerate heat, drought, and poor soils remarkably well. Regular deadheading encourages continuous flowering and helps maintain a neat appearance.

Seed Sowing Instructions

  • Start seeds indoors 6-8 weeks before the last frost or sow directly outdoors after frost danger has passed.
  • Cover seeds lightly with soil.
  • Maintain temperatures between 65-75°F (18-24°C).
  • Germination generally occurs within 10-21 days.
  • Space plants 12-18 inches apart.
  • Provide full sun and excellent drainage.

JB249 African Daisy Harlequin Mix ( Arctotis hybrida )

African Daisy Harlequin Mix is a dazzling blend of brightly colored daisy-like flowers that brings the vibrant spirit of South Africa directly into the garden. This spectacular mixture produces large blooms in brilliant shades of orange, scarlet, bronze, gold, cream, white, yellow, and bi-colors, many featuring dramatic dark centers and contrasting rings that create an almost painted appearance. The result is a kaleidoscope of color that remains eye-catching from late spring through fall.

Each flower opens wide in sunshine, revealing intricate patterns and vivid color combinations that seem almost too perfect to be natural. The compact, bushy plants become covered with blooms, creating a cheerful display that is equally at home in flower beds, borders, containers, and wildflower plantings.

Growing Information

Harlequin Mix thrives in full sun and well-drained soil. Plants typically grow 12 to 18 inches tall and develop a compact, spreading habit covered with flowers throughout the growing season. They perform especially well in sunny locations where heat and bright light encourage abundant blooming.

Once established, African Daisies are remarkably drought tolerant and continue flowering through periods of hot, dry weather. Removing spent blooms helps promote continuous flowering and keeps plants looking fresh and vigorous.

Seed Sowing Instructions

  • Start seeds indoors 6-8 weeks before the last frost or sow outdoors after danger of frost has passed.
  • Cover seeds lightly with soil.
  • Maintain temperatures between 65-75°F (18-24°C).
  • Germination generally occurs within 10-21 days.
  • Space plants 10-12 inches apart.
  • Provide full sun and excellent drainage.
